PSYC 4163 - Cognition 3(3-0)
Prerequisite(s): PSYC 1103 and PSYC 2203 .
Introduction to the area of cognition. The course examines cognitive processes, including perception, attention, memory, comprehension, reasoning, decision-making, and problem-solving. The course will give an understanding of the methods used to gather and evaluate evidence about cognitive processes, and an understanding of the ways in which knowledge of these processes has been applied to solve problems and improve the quality of life.
